The School of Social Work is an integral part of Salem State College, a vibrant state college in historic Salem, Massachusetts with over 150 years of educating for excellence in public service. The College established an undergraduate social work major in 1969 - a major that was accredited by the Council on Social Work Education (CSWE) as a BSW Program in 1979. When the MSW Program was founded in 1986, the College formally established the School of Social Work. Both Programs remain fully accredited by CSWE and firmly rooted in the College's commitment to the highest standards of education for human services - education achieved at an affordable cost.

The School of Social Work has extended the College's commitment to human services by educating students specifically for professional social work practice in public and non-profit service sectors. The School's graduates are making distinctive contributions to direct practice, administrative leadership, and policy as well as program development throughout Massachusetts, New England, and beyond. At the same time, the School's faculty and staff contribute to social work knowledge and practice through their research and scholarship as well as their extensive service in local, national, and international communities.

The School's mission as well as the BSW and MSW Programs' goals and curricula reflect the social work profession's values and ethics, especially with regard to the preparation of practitioners who competently provide social work services for diverse populations as well as populations at risk for social and economic injustice. Students work closely with faculty and their peers in small classes in order to fully develop the knowledge and skills needed to understand and competently address complex human needs and rights. Because the School is located on the North Shore of Boston, students' field education occurs in some of the nation's leading public and non-profit agencies and organizations throughout New England.
